What Is the Lease Tax Credit? The Inflation Reduction Act (IRA) of 2022 made a tax credit of up to $7,500 available to qualifying purchasers of certain EVs. But …Last August, the Inflation Reduction Act signed into law, which takes effect this week, restricted a federal tax credit of up to $7,500 to vehicles built in North America. There is currently a loophole that exists within the Inflation Reduction Act that allows leased EVs to skip past some tax credit ...Use Form 8936 to figure your credit for qualified plug-in electric drive motor vehicles you placed in service during your tax year. Also use Form 8936 to figure your credit for certain qualified two-wheeled plug-in electric vehicles and new clean vehicles discussed under What's New , earlier.
